Healthcare Compliance Risk Assessment Checklist

February 06, 2024 (2 min read)

Evaluate the thoroughness and effectiveness of your healthcare organization clients’ compliance programs. Scale this checklist—which aligns with guidance provided by the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services Office of Inspector General—for use with large and small organizations alike. Walk your clients through the desired scope of their assessments, their methods for identifying risks, their understanding of regulatory requirements, how they rank identified risks, and how they can remediate adverse findings.
